2026/2/6 12:29:51
网站建设
项目流程
台北网站建设,桐乡市城市规划建设局网站,项目分享平台,河北建设工程信息网招标公告唐县水利局目录 STM32单片机激光测距仪套件概述硬件组成功能实现开发环境与代码示例应用场景 源码文档获取/同行可拿货,招校园代理 #xff1a;文章底部获取博主联系方式#xff01; STM32单片机激光测距仪套件概述
该嵌入式套件基于STM32单片机设计#xff0c;整合激光测距模块、防撞…目录STM32单片机激光测距仪套件概述硬件组成功能实现开发环境与代码示例应用场景源码文档获取/同行可拿货,招校园代理 文章底部获取博主联系方式STM32单片机激光测距仪套件概述该嵌入式套件基于STM32单片机设计整合激光测距模块、防撞报警及倒车雷达功能适用于智能小车、工业测距、安防监控等场景。核心模块包括STM32主控、激光测距传感器、蜂鸣器/LED报警模块及显示单元支持实时距离测量与多级阈值报警。硬件组成STM32主控芯片通常采用STM32F103系列具备高性能Cortex-M3内核支持PWM、ADC、UART等外设可高效处理测距数据并控制外围模块。激光测距模块常用VL53L0X或HY-SRF05测量范围0.05-4米视型号而定精度达±1mm通过I²C或GPIO与主控通信。报警模块蜂鸣器或LED灯根据预设阈值如30cm、50cm触发声光报警。显示单元可选OLED或LCD屏实时显示距离信息。电源管理支持5V直流输入内置稳压电路为各模块供电。功能实现距离测量激光模块发射信号并接收反射光STM32计算时间差转换为距离值公式为[\text{距离} \frac{\text{光速} \times \text{时间差}}{2}]防撞报警用户可编程设置安全距离阈值当实测距离低于阈值时触发蜂鸣器高频报警或LED闪烁。倒车雷达模式支持多级报警如远/中/近距通过PWM控制蜂鸣器频率变化模拟传统雷达提示音。开发环境与代码示例开发工具为Keil MDK或STM32CubeIDE需配置HAL库或标准外设库。以下为VL53L0X测距的简化代码片段#includevl53l0x.huint16_tdistance;VL53L0X_Init();// 初始化激光模块while(1){distanceVL53L0X_GetDistance();// 获取距离值if(distance300)Buzzer_On();// 低于30cm报警HAL_Delay(100);}应用场景智能小车避障与路径规划。工业自动化物料高度检测或机械臂定位。消费电子倒车辅助系统或家居安防监控。该套件提供开源资料原理图、PCB设计、示例代码适合嵌入式开发者快速二次开发。源码文档获取/同行可拿货,招校园代理 文章底部获取博主联系方式需要成品或者定制加我们的时候不满意的可以定制文章最下方名片联系我即可~